An investigation has determined allegations of unprofessional conduct by members of the RCMP and the city fire department at the Legion Hall on Remembrance Day are unfounded, Mayor Dan Rogers said Friday.
"The investigation findings revealed that city fire fighters or RCMP members were not participants in any physical altercation during Remembrance Day celebrations at the Royal Canadian Legion, nor was there determined to be inappropriate conduct by any of those members," Rogers said during a press conference at city hall.
He said the investigation was launched by the Prince George RCMP and the International Association of Firefighters Local 1372 after the city became aware of allegations from a story in Wednesday's Prince George Citizen.
